Each college should aim for a weekly schedule that includes at least 5-6 hours a week covering the Academic Cooperative queue. Each college's answering percentage should be at 75% (answering percentage = the number of chat sessions requested on your service divided by the number of chat sessions your staff answered). If a college's answering percentage dips below 75%, it should staff additional weekly hours.

Scheduling Guidelines

When setting up your schedule for monitoring, always refer first to the set of preferred days and times as determined by QuestionPoint. Wherever possible, try to cover the time slots marked on this page in red, yellow, or blue. Then, look at the 2008 report that shows chat sessions by hour on the CUNY cooperative and try to be online during those hours of the day when most chat sessions are coming in.
